Why Does My Big Dog Need to Be Groomed?
It is a misconception to think that larger dogs do not need to be groomed because they don’t need haircuts. It is actually just as important for a large dog to be groomed as it is for a small dog. Mainly because dogs, large or small, need regular baths. Over time they can begin to smell, get debris tangled in their fur, or develop a skin condition that you may not see through their fur. Dogs nails grow just like ours and need to be trimmed to avoid damage and pain from walking, digging, or scratching. While at the groomer, their ears are cleaned out, and there is an option to have their anal glands released. Keep in mind, large dogs enjoy being pampered just like small dogs with a bubble bath massage, and a nice calming blow dry.
